Carambola Upside Down Cake (Photo below)

Ingredients |
|
3 to 4 |
carambolas, sliced |
1/4 cup |
butter, melted |
2/3 cup |
dark brown sugar |

juice of 2 passion fruit |
1/2 cup |
butter, softened |
1 cup |
sugar |
2 |
eggs |
1 1/2 cups |
cake flour |
1 1/2 teaspoons |
baking powder
pinch of salt |
1/2 cup |
milk |
1 teaspoon |
vanilla extract |
1 teaspoon |
almond extract |

Preparation |
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Arrange sliced carambolas in bottom of a greased 9-inch cake pan as close together as possible. Mix together 1/4 cup butter, brown sugar and passion fruit juice and pour into pan, turning so mixture covers bottom. Set aside. Cream together 1/2 cup of butter and sugar. Add eggs, one at a time, beat well. Mix together dry ingredients. Add flour mixture, alternately with milk, to butter mixture. Stir in vanilla and almond extracts. Pour into prepared cake pan. Bake for approximately 30 minutes or until cake pulls away form sides of pan. Let cool for 5 minutes before inverting onto serving plate.
Yield
8 servings
